Cloud Station HILFE! Cloud Station fügt Bezeichnung "CONFLICT" und andere Daten zu den Dateinamen

  • Ab sofort steht euch hier im Forum die neue Add-on Verwaltung zur Verfügung – eine zentrale Plattform für alles rund um Erweiterungen und Add-ons für den DSM.

    Damit haben wir einen Ort, an dem Lösungen von Nutzern mit der Community geteilt werden können. Über die Team Funktion können Projekte auch gemeinsam gepflegt werden.

    Was die Add-on Verwaltung kann und wie es funktioniert findet Ihr hier

    Hier geht es zu den Add-ons

Status
Für weitere Antworten geschlossen.

Jigme

Benutzer
Registriert
09. Feb. 2013
Beiträge
4
Reaktionspunkte
0
Punkte
0
HILFE! Cloud Station fügt Bezeichnung "CONFLICT" und andere Daten zu den Dateinamen

Hallo,

seit ein paar Tage ändert die Cloud Station die Namen von TXT-Dateien, die zu einem CAT-Programm (Computer Aided Translation) gehören und oft in kurzen Abständen (10 Sek.) aktualisiert werden, und zwar wird der Benutzername, das aktuelle Datum und das Wort "CONFLICT" hinzugefügt.

Bsp.: ABC.txt wird in ABC_ALEX_Jul-14-1026-2013_Conflict.txt geändert

Das CAT-Tool kann natürlich nichts damit anfangen :mad:.

Weißt jemand rat?

Konfiguration: Windows 8, DS213+, SW 4.2

Beste Grüße
Alex
 
Die Datei sagt es ja schon, sie steht mit dem Inhalt einer anderen Datei in Konflikt, welche von einem anderen Client vor kurzem bearbeitet wurde. Was genau willst du mit der Cloud bewirken? Sieht so aus, als ob 2 Clients fast gleichzeitig an der Datei arbeiten und diese dann speichern wollen, aber das ist ja dann logisch, dass es zu einem Konflikt auf der Serverseite kommt.
 
...Sieht so aus, als ob 2 Clients fast gleichzeitig an der Datei arbeiten und diese dann speichern wollen...

Es könnte aber auch sein, das die Zeit auf Client und Server nicht synchron läuft und so dieser Dateikonflikt entsteht. Es könnte auch sein, das der Zeitintervall an sich (im 10 Sek. Takt) für die CloudStation zu kurz bemessen ist.

Dieses Verhalten ist aber erst seit ein paar Tagen? Hat es vorher funktioniert? Hast du was geändert? Die CloudStation aktuallisiert? Welche CS-Version verwendest du (Server- wie Clientseitig)?

Tommes
 
Ich habe teilweise auch das Verhalten der CloudStation wenn der Client nicht am Netz hängt und die Datei in der Zwischenzeit von einem anderen Client bearbeitet worden ist. Nachdem der 1. Client wieder Verbindung hat enstehen auch die Conflicts. Allerdings kann man meiner Erfahrung raus diese fast alle löschen. Aber man sollte trotzdem vorsichtig sein. Lieber vorher nochmal die Inhalte vergleichen.
 
Vielen Dank für Eure Antworten,


- ich glaube, dass der 2. Client (mein Laptop) hier keine Rolle spielt, da er seit mind. 1 Woche ausgeschaltet ist;

- ja, ich hatte von ein paar Tage einen Update des CS-Pakets installiert; davor hat seit Februar alles bestens funktioniert (ich frage mich ob man zurück-updaten kann ohne eine komplette Recovery der Festplatte C ausführen zu müssen?);

- die TXT-Dateien (sog. Translation-Memories und selbstherstellte Glossare (beide bis 9 MB Text)) werden nicht ständig, sondern nur Zeitweise in kurzen Zeitintervallen aktualisiert (d. h. je nachdem wie schnell ich einen Satz in die andere Sprache übersetze).

- die Conflict-Dateien werden nicht hinzugefügt, sondern es werden ausschließlich die Originaldateien unbenannt, so dass ich sie nicht einfach löschen kann

- die CS Version des Clients habe ich heute Morgen aktualisiert, nachdem ich die besagten conflict-dateien entdeckt habe


Alex
 
Hi!

- ich glaube, dass der 2. Client (mein Laptop) hier keine Rolle spielt, da er seit mind. 1 Woche ausgeschaltet ist;
Das hatte ich bereits vermutet.

- ja, ich hatte von ein paar Tage einen Update des CS-Pakets installiert; davor hat seit Februar alles bestens funktioniert (ich frage mich ob man zurück-updaten kann ohne eine komplette Recovery der Festplatte C ausführen zu müssen?);
Die aktuelle und "Offizielle" Version der CloudStation für den DSM 4.2 3211 ist die Version 2.0-2402. Das Update, welches du durchgeführt hast, ist bestimmt das der DSM Beta 4.3 3750. Das wäre dann die CloudStation Version 2.1 2537.
Im Prinzip spricht nichts gegen den Einsatz dieser CloudStation Version. Man muß sich jedoch bewußt sein, das es sich hierbei um einen "Beta-Status" handelt und daher mit Fehlern rechnen muß. Es kann also durchaus Möglich sein, das dieser Fehler im Beta-Status der CS tatsächlich auftritt, es kann aber auch daran gelegen haben, das du zwei unterschiedliche Versionen auf dem Server und dem Client verwendet hast. Vielleicht hat sich das Problem ja schon erledigt. Wenn nicht, könntest du durchaus mal einen Request-Report an den Synolog-Support senden und denen auf diesen Fehler aufmerksam machen.
Ein zurück-Updaten ist imho nicht möglich. Kann sein, das man das durch deinstallieren und wieder installieren hinbekommt, würde da aber meine Hand nicht für ins Feuer legen wollen. Ich meine damit, das man dieses Downgrade nicht ohne Datenverlust durchführen kann. Mit Datenverlust geht das auf jeden Fall!

- die Conflict-Dateien werden nicht hinzugefügt, sondern es werden ausschließlich die Originaldateien unbenannt, so dass ich sie nicht einfach löschen kann
Ja, das ist vollkommen richtig. Das wird durch die CS so gehandhabt.

- die CS Version des Clients habe ich heute Morgen aktualisiert, nachdem ich die besagten conflict-dateien entdeckt habe
Dann beobachte mal, ob das Problem weiterhin besteht.

Tommes
 
Zuletzt bearbeitet:
ich schalte mich hier auch einmal ein...
auf meinem Client (Win 8.1 64bit) ist die Version CS 2.1-2577. Die DS hat die aktuelle Firmware und die aktuellen Pakete.
Nur ein Client greift bei mir auf die DS zu. In der Anlage habe ich einen Screenshot angefügt, der den kompl. PC und seine "conlict-Dateien" anzeigt.


conflict.jpg

Mir geht es hauptsächlich um Datei 2 bis 4.
 
ich kenne dieses "Phänomen" nur wenn mehrere Clients beteiligt sind und einer davon besonders langsam ist und die Änderungen nicht so schnell verarbeiten kann. Normalerweise ist der Client der Übeltäter, dessen Name im Namen der Conflict-Datei steht. In dem letzten Screenshot erkenne ich übrigens drei Clients... Ich würde das Problem also auf dem av-work vermuten...
Datenbank-Dateien sind normalerweise immer im Zugriff und für andere Anwendungen nicht nutzbar, deswegen kann ich mir vorstellen, dass diese mgz-Dateien selbst ein richtiges Synchronisieren verhindern...

Stefan
 
hallo Stefan,
ich sehe nur "2".
Wobei der erste der Admin der DS ist und der zweite mein Client-PC ist.
 
av-work, arch, amd-6000...
wer die syno ist, kann ich nicht erkennen. arch?

Stefan
 
sorry,
AMD6100 ist der Name des Clienten gewesen, bevor ich Win8.1 installiert habe. Also nicht mehr von relevanz und nicht mehr existent.
 
Moin,
was wäre denn nun der "Schulmäßige" umgang mit diesen conflict-Dateien?

Mein versuch:
- "Aktuellste" Datei am Client heraussuchen
- Ausserhalb der Cloud wegschreiben und umbenennen
- Conflict-Datei von Client und Server löschen
- Weggeschriebene Datei beim Client wieder einfügen

Resultat:
Kaum hab ich den letzten beschriebenen schritt getan, ist es auch schon wieder ein conflict... :(

Kann es sein das, um konflikte zu beheben, die beteiligten Clients online sein müssen?!?
(Wäre bei mir unpraktisch, da u.a. Heim und Firmen Rechner gesynct werden...)


bin für jede Hilfe dankbar!

PS:
Mein System ist eine DS411j mit DSM 5.0Beta und CS Beta 3.0-3005
 
Die beteiligten Geräte müssen nicht online sein,
die Conflict-Dateien entstehen meist, wenn die beteiligten Gerätschaften unterschiedlich schnell auf Änderungen reagieren oder wenn z.B. das mehrmalige Abspeichern einer Datei zu schnell nacheinander erfolgt.
Die Datei sollte man aber nur auf einer Seite löschen, sonst entstehen gleich die nächsten Conflict-Dateien und bevor man die Datei wieder reinkopiert, sollte man kurz warten, weil der Sync evtl. noch nicht fertig ist und dann auch wieder Conflict-Dateien entstehen.

Stefan
 
manchmal reuicht es schon

Moin,
was wäre denn nun der "Schulmäßige" umgang mit diesen conflict-Dateien?

Mein versuch:
- "Aktuellste" Datei am Client heraussuchen
- Ausserhalb der Cloud wegschreiben und umbenennen
- Conflict-Datei von Client und Server löschen
- Weggeschriebene Datei beim Client wieder einfügen

Resultat:
Kaum hab ich den letzten beschriebenen schritt getan, ist es auch schon wieder ein conflict... :(

Kann es sein das, um konflikte zu beheben, die beteiligten Clients online sein müssen?!?
(Wäre bei mir unpraktisch, da u.a. Heim und Firmen Rechner gesynct werden...)


bin für jede Hilfe dankbar!

PS:
Mein System ist eine DS411j mit DSM 5.0Beta und CS Beta 3.0-3005

wenn man die Cloud auf dem Client beendet und zusätzlich den Client Prozess beendet > Dann kann man bequem die Dateinamen korrigieren und die Cloud wieder starten! Ich weiß, dass ist sicherlich nicht der ideale Weg. Bei "Wiso Mein Geld" mache ich es so, dass ich erst den Server starte, wenn die Datenbanken auf den aktuellen Stand gebracht wurden...
Ich denke das Synology hier noch Hand anlegen muß. Hab momentan noch ca. 26 Conflict-Dateien, die aber nicht wichtig sind.
 
Kleiner Tip um alles conflict Dateien auf einmal zurückzubenennen.

Dazu nehme ich das Programm ReNamer

1. Im Windows Explorer oder Total Commander nach "_Conflict." suchen.
2. Alle gefunden Dateien per Drag n Drop in den ReNamer ziehen.
3. Auf das Plus klicken und die Regel "Remove" auswählen.
Entsprechend eurer Conflict Dateien anpassen. Habe das Sternchen als wildcard für das Datum genommen.
rule.PNG

conflict remove.jpg

Nach dem Ausführen gab es das Problem das viele Dateien schon vorhanden sind und somit nicht umbenannt werden konnten.

In den Einstellungen kann man jedoch festlegen das diese Dateien überschrieben werden.
Weis leider nicht wie man noch festlegen könnte das die größte bzw. neuste Datei erhalten bleibt. Bin jedoch froh die tausenden Conflict Dateien überhaupt loszuwerden.
rename overwrite.PNG

Hoffe das hat auch euch was genützt.
 
und wieder ich,
nachdem ich ca. 1 Woche Ruhe mit der DS und dem einen Client hatte, geht es heute schon wieder los...
 

Anhänge

  • conflict.jpg
    conflict.jpg
    39,5 KB · Aufrufe: 76
Ich habe es auch manchmal das Problem mit den Conflict-Dateien
Aber nicht so wie hier:
Zitat Zitat von Jigme Beitrag anzeigen
- die Conflict-Dateien werden nicht hinzugefügt, sondern es werden ausschließlich die Originaldateien unbenannt, so dass ich sie nicht einfach löschen kann

sondern bei mir entsteht eine neue Datei mit dem Zusatz Conflict, ich habe die Datei also doppelt.

Der Verursacher ist aber immer mein Galaxy S 3 Handy. Es kommt aber zum Glück selten vor.
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at